I cannot speak highly enough of the staff at Kettering following my childs sporting injury resulting in a trip to A&E and emergency surgery. A&E took some time; but then sitting waiting anywhere seems to take forever! Especially when you have an injured child to worry about! The staff were friendly and helpful and offered us reassyrance refreshments and kept us informed all the way along. The surgeon and anaesthetist came to see us, were informative and helped us feel (a little bit) calmer prior to the little one going down to theatre. The Surgery went wonderfully, the recovery nurses were fabulous , the skylark staff were fabulous, the facilities on the children's ward were fresh and modern and made a really quite horrid time bearable. My child actually enjoyed the stay - played play station and was relaxed and well cared for throughout. Thank you is all u can say !
